What to do in NYC on Labor Day Weekend
The New York Yankees are playing the Baltimore Orioles over the weekend and the Chicago White Sox on Monday at Yankee Stadium in Bronx, NY. Celebrate the end of summer with one of the best summer sports. Football starts the next week too, so be ready to cheer on the NY Giants or the NY Jets after Labor Day is over.
New York City street fairs are going strong through the fall, and this is one of the most popular weekend to get out and explore local produce, update your wardrobe and of course enjoy a fun afternoon people watching. Some of the popular festivals and street fairs in NYC Labor Day weekend 2013 include the 29th Annual Brazilian Day Festival, the Washington Square Outdoor Art Exhibit and the Richmond County fair.
NYC Labor Day weekend sales make for a fantastic, and hectic, time to snag some of the best fashions in some of the most glamorous places to shop in New York City. Annual sales like the Labor Day weekend sale at Barney’s, Woodbury Common Outlets and more draw huge crowds and make for an exciting day of shopping in New York City.
Enjoy the last swim of summer in New York City over Labor Day weekend too. After Labor Day, the 14 miles of beaches in NYC close for the season. This is the perfect time to head out to the shore with the family, or enjoy some time on the water with a little more adventure. Check out all the fun things to do at NYC beaches, like exciting jet ski rentals. Don’t miss the last opportunity to spend a day at the beach in NYC this season.
